Title: THE WIZARD JAPAN (VHS Cover) Summary: The title "The Wizard Japan" refers to a Japanese VHS release of the 1989 American fantasy film, The Wizard. This video cassette cover specifically highlights the Japanese version of the movie. "The Wizard" is a family-friendly adventure film directed by Todd Holland and starring Fred Savage, Luke Edwards, and Christian Slater. In this movie, a young boy named Jimmy is on a quest to compete in a video game tournament with his brother, who has a natural talent for gaming. The Japanese VHS cover may vary from the original American cover in design and language content, reflecting local cultural influences and marketing strategies. The VHS format was popular during the late 20th century as a means of home entertainment before the widespread adoption of digital media.
